My Favorite Bands Logo
    Maggotron
    Maggotron

    Pioneering Florida electro/bass group lead by James McCauley aka DXJ, which recorded under many pseudonyms and with many varied lineups. They are known for their wildly creative and tongue-in-cheek approach to music.

    Data provided by Discogs